NGO Lawyers for Human Rights International offers free legal aid to victims of Dera violence
By Vijay Pal Brar
Chandigarh, August 30, 2017: The NGO Lawyers for Human Rights International on Wednesday announced free legal aid for the victims of Dera violence.
The NGO Founder Gen. Secy. Navkiran Singh said at a news conference here that anybody who became victim of the violence unleashed by followers of the rape convict Sirsa Dera chief can approach them for seeking relief through legal process.
Besides long time Dera follower Gurdas Singh Toor, another former follower Hans Raj who was allegedly castrated among other male followers at the behest of convicted Dera chief was also present.
The case of Hans Raj is already being investigated by the CBI on the directions of the Punjab and Haryana High Court. Its court hearing is almost in final stage.
Toor claimed that more disclosures could be made about what was happening inside the Dera if the government ordered its thourough search.
